Страница 4 из 6

Re: ADTECH CNC4620

Добавлено: 25 фев 2018, 13:02
Руслан_cnc
Спасибо за ответы.
Уточните пожалуйста:
1. При E-stopе шпиндель отключается или нет.
2. Вопрос про лимиты, а не про Home. Но ответ нашёл в инструкции. Я читал инструкцию к CNC4640 от ECT-Automation, а не от ADTech. Посмотрел что в инструкции от ECT в конце есть примеры программ для реализации автоматической смены инструмента и подумал что она более полная чем от ADTech, а оказалось что нет.
3. Английский знаю в достаточном объёме, с этим проблем нет. Интересовал не перевод, а их функции в системе, но в мануале от ADTech нашёл.
4. OK.
5. Получается для датчиков Home индуктивные не прокатят? Что-то мне кажется я где-то читал что сначала ищет сработку датчика на выводе Home Input, а потом отъезжает и ищет Z-метку. Неужели ошибаюсь :eh:

Re: ADTECH CNC4620

Добавлено: 25 фев 2018, 13:10
Руслан_cnc
Всё-таки нашёл, в мануале всё чётко:
For mechanical home, the external home sensor switch is used to locate the origin of the machine tool;
two checking modes are available:
1. With the external sensor switch, the home operation completes when the sensing is successfully
repeatedly.
2. The external sensor switch is used as deceleration switch, the servo home is enabled as home signal after
sensing and then the sensing stops.

Если я правильно понял, мой вариант номер 2.

Re: ADTECH CNC4620

Добавлено: 25 фев 2018, 17:40
odekolon
хотелось бы,
если реализуете, отпишитесь пожалуйста

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 10:29
Руслан_cnc
А Вы пробовали так делать или нет или в мануале описано, а на деле не работает.
В своей схеме электроавтоматики я решил не заводить E-stop на контактор, подающий силу на привода и частотник(+ насосы и др.), так как при нажатии на E-stop(на порте выносного пульта), как я понял, останавливается движение осей, останавливается шпиндель и выключается насос СОЖ(да и по идее весь выходной порт). Так что не вижу смысла отрубать силу от приводов что бы они по инерции вращались и могли натворить неприятных дел. Позже выложу схему на обсуждение.

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 11:11
odekolon
Руслан_cnc писал(а):А Вы пробовали так делать или нет или в мануале описано, а на деле не работает.
конечно не пробовал. Я вообще сомневаюсь, что сигналы от энкодеров, как-то обрабатываются. Но поэкспериментируйте, может получится.
Руслан_cnc писал(а):В своей схеме электроавтоматики я решил не заводить E-stop на контактор, подающий силу на привода и частотник(+ насосы и др.), так как при нажатии на E-stop(на порте выносного пульта), как я понял, останавливается движение осей, останавливается шпиндель и выключается насос СОЖ(да и по идее весь выходной порт). Так что не вижу смысла отрубать силу от приводов что бы они по инерции вращались и могли натворить неприятных дел. Позже выложу схему на обсуждение.
Черт его знает, как правильно...
В промышленных станках, грибок ESTOP и наезд на аварийные конечники, рубит питание нахрен, на случай если стойка откажет.
в слабых любительских станках, большого смысла рвать питание не вижу, ну тюкнется портал об упор, если что. да и фиг с ним. И то в случае, если стойка глюканет.

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 13:27
Руслан_cnc
Для меня наличие и правильная работа E-stop очень важна, так как станок не маленький, да и сервы 1.2 kW и 1.5kW. Я когда покупал стойку переписывался с продавцом и спрашивал про входы от энкодера в стойку, вот часть переписки:
//============================================================================================================
Я:
Hi, please answer for one question. If I connected encoder outputs on QS7 drive OA+, OA-, OB+, OB-, OZ+ and OZ- to CNC4640 axis connector, need I to connect output of QS7 drive ECZ+ and ECZ- to CNC4640 input port for precision homing or OZ- and OZ+ are equal to ECZ+ and ECZ- ? I read about settings of homing function that first controller seek mechanical home switch and then Z-signal of encoder.

Продавец:
Hi Ruslan. For homing, you can connect QS7 CN1 Pin30 (OZ+) , Pin31(OZ-) To CNC4640
Actually Pin28 (CZ+) , Pin29(CZ-) Are simillar to PIN30 PIN31,
The difference is : PIn28 pin28 are open-collector output, PIN30 PIN31, are differential output.... so it is better connect pin30,pin31, they can connect to CNC4640 OZ+ OZ - directly.
//============================================================================================================
Я:
Ok, thanks. Why we need to connect encoder outputs to cnc4640? Do cnc4640 corrects pulse output regarding to incoming encoder signals?

Продавец:
no need connect servo driver encoder outputs to cnc4640
CNC4640 do not correct and compensate the pulse value .
if you connect, it just show the income pluse on screen, nothing else.

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 13:32
MGG
Китайцы мне сказали, что у них вообще нет стоек with feedback :D

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 14:17
Руслан_cnc
Вот примерные наброски схемы(не полный и не последний вариант).

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 14:25
Hanter
Я когда по своей спрашивал, мне ответили что индексные метки она понимает. под них и входы есть. а под энкодер только для шпинделя.

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 14:56
Руслан_cnc
А кто что по схеме скажет.

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 15:16
Руслан_cnc
Алtксей, а у Вас получилось реализовать метод поиска Home, который я описал?

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 20:21
odekolon
Руслан_cnc писал(а):Вот примерные наброски схемы(не полный и не последний вариант).
Мелко очень, не видать нифига...

Re: ADTECH CNC4620

Добавлено: 26 фев 2018, 22:07
Руслан_cnc
Почему не видать нефига? Снизу картинки есть "Загрузить оригинал", там всё видно.

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 09:41
odekolon
А ну да, не заметил.
Схема вполне себе нормальна, я б только питание ЧП, подключил бы после пускателя, вместе с драйверами

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 10:35
Руслан_cnc
А нет ли какого сигнала готовности со стойки после её загрузки? Хорошо было бы его использовать для включения силы.
Очень интересует подключение дополнительной панели. Если у кого есть панель сделайте фото с лицевой и обратной(плату) стороны. Общение со стойкой по какому-то протоколу или просто сигналы с кнопок? Есть желание самому сделать на микроконтроллере, но инфы нет пока никакой.

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 11:07
Hanter
Руслан_cnc писал(а):Алtксей, а у Вас получилось реализовать метод поиска Home, который я описал?
Руслан нет. станок на который она бралась внезапно сменил владельца.. :)

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 12:00
odekolon
Руслан_cnc писал(а):А нет ли какого сигнала готовности со стойки после её загрузки? Хорошо было бы его использовать для включения силы.
Очень интересует подключение дополнительной панели. Если у кого есть панель сделайте фото с лицевой и обратной(плату) стороны. Общение со стойкой по какому-то протоколу или просто сигналы с кнопок? Есть желание самому сделать на микроконтроллере, но инфы нет пока никакой.
Руслан, вы там как будто прокатный стан строите...
Стойка мелокобюджетная. Ниже, только контроллеры для роутеров.
Если очень хочется функционала, нужно брать сименс/фанук/балтсистем/фмс3000/цнц8 и так далее..

доп панель, явно по какому-то протоколу подключается. Может быть по внутреннему.

Если очень хочется плюшек, трясите продавца, о том как устроена электроавтоматика (она там есть) и над ней изгаляйтесь.
А форумчане вас поддержат, помогут советом и сочуствием. :D

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 12:53
Hanter
odekolon писал(а):Стойка мелокобюджетная. Ниже, только контроллеры для роутеров. Если очень хочется функционала, нужно брать сименс/фанук/балтсистем/фмс3000/цнц8 и так далее..
Борис, а можно поподробнее. чем тот же фанук, балтсистем, ФМС будут более функциональными ? я вроде глядел - все основное она делает. понятно что "быстрого програмирования" и визардов как у сименса нету, но от нее и требовать это грех.. а так.... может не углядел чего.. я пока не запускал. счас с новым железом порешаю и буду потихоньку тоже подключаться.

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 13:28
odekolon
прежде всего, как раз той пресловутой электроавтоматикой.
Это позволяет управлять довольно извращенными электрогидропневматическими системами. Например при задании оборотов шпинделя, электроавтоматика сама включит нужную передачу.
или на расточном станке, при движении, снимет блокировку оси.
Или скажем такая простейшая вещь как смазка направляющих, не знаю как у других, а у балтсистема можно включать смазку после определенного пробега, по осям что экономичнее чем по времени.
есть возможность создавать свои пользовательские меню-экраны, для удобства операторов, ну скажем для работы с рейнишоу или еще с чем.

ну и параметров настройки намного больше, можно настроить скорости -ускорения в соответствии с динамическими параметрами осей, что позволяет повысить точность следования траектории на высоких скоростях. А это путь к повышению точности и производительности.
У фанука есть туева хуча тонких настроек G-кода, но я туда не лазил.
Вообще, только настройки стойки, у фанука, занимают две толстенные книжицы. А есть еще настройки приводов, описание языка электроавтоматики и т.п.
Хотя чаще всего, на эти параметры забивают, или оставляют "по умолчанию" или "на усмотрение приводов"

у правильных стоек есть возможность отслеживать реальное положение осей (по цифровым линейкам) .

Наверное еще чего-то упустил, я ведь не "великий специалист" по стойкам, а просто инженер-электронщик.

Re: ADTECH CNC4620

Добавлено: 27 фев 2018, 17:28
Руслан_cnc
Понятно что не прокатный стан строю, но мощности двигателей на станке такие, что последствия, в плане человеческих увечий или серьёзной поломки станка, могут быть очень не приятные. Так что хочется сделать всё по уму на сколько это возможно.
Насчёт электроавтоматики, я считаю что в этой стойке есть всё что нужно и не нужен PLC и знание языка на котором его программируют. Поясню. Мне понравилось что можно написать обычную программу с G-кодом и макропеременными в которой можно опросить какой-нибудь пин на входном порту или установить нужный лог. сигнал на выходе. Так реализована смена инструмента на данной стойке. Есть и другой момент, много чем нам может помочь правильный постпроцессор, который например анализируя задание числа оборотов, пришедшие из Cldata, может добавить дополнительный М-код, который переключит механическую скорость шпинделя или переключит со звезды на треугольник обмотки мотора шпинделя, так же и с разблокировкой осей при начале движения. Кстати и при пробеге определённого расстояния тоже может вставить команду смазки осей. А количества физических выходов на стойке, как по мне, так вполне хватает.